The true length of a year on Earth is 365.2422 days, or about 365.25 days. The calendar in sync with the seasons by having most years 365 days long but making just under 1/4 of all years 366 day "leap years".
A leap year is a year with one extra day inserted into February, which will have 29 days. Leap year's are needed to keep the calendar in alignment with the earth's revolutions around the sun.
